What's Happening?
Nikkiso Clean Energy & Industrial Gases Group has been contracted by NPG, a joint venture between Shell and a subsidiary of FOCOL Holdings Limited, to provide LNG regasification and cryogenic equipment for the New Providence Gas Project in Nassau, Bahamas. The project involves an LNG receiving terminal to support additional power generation at Clifton Pier, transitioning from diesel to LNG-powered gas turbines. Nikkiso will supply a modular regasification system, including high-pressure pumps, vaporizers, and insulated pipelines, along with engineering services.
Why It's Important?
The Bahamas LNG-to-power project represents a significant shift towards lower-carbon energy solutions in the region. By transitioning from diesel to LNG, the project aims to reduce carbon emissions and enhance energy efficiency. Nikkiso's involvement underscores the growing demand for advanced cryogenic technology in energy infrastructure projects. This initiative could serve as a model for other island nations seeking sustainable energy solutions, potentially influencing regional energy policies and investment strategies.
